科目一英文版怎么考

1、The cycle for recording the accumulated penalty points for violating road traffic regulations is ____________.

A. 14 months

B. 12 months

C. 6 months

D. 10 months

Answer:B

2、Opening the doors of a motorized vehicle should not obstruct the flow of other vehicles and pedestrians.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:A

3、When driving at night, the driver should go at a lower speed because his field of vision is limited and he can hardly observe the traffic conditions beyond the area covered by his vehicle light.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:A

4、Stopping the vehicle temporarily in the crosswalk is the act of violation of the law.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:A

5、When the vehicle has changed its direction due to a front tire blowout on the road, the driver should firmly hold the steering wheel with both hands to ensure the vehicle goes straight.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:A

6、When starting up a vehicle stopping at the roadside, the driver should first ________.

A. Depress the accelerator pedal and start

B. Honk

C. Increase engine rotation speed

D. Observe the conditions around the vehicles

Answer:D

8、If the applicant commits bribery or cheating in the course of a test, his eligibility for this test will be cancelled and the results of other tests he has passed will be invalid.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:A

9、When a motorized vehicle stops temporarily at the roadside, the driver ________.

A. Is not allowed to stop in the opposite direction or in parallel

B. May stop anyway he likes as long as it is convenient for him to get out

C. May stop the vehicle in the opposite direction

D. May stop the vehicle in parallel

Answer:A

10、A motorized vehicle driver who reverses, drives in the opposite direction or make a U turn by crossing the central dividing strip on the expressway is subject to a 6-point penalty.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:B

12、When a vehicle passes a level crossing, the driver should use the low gear to pass and should not change gear halfway in order to avoid engine kill.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:A

13、When the fire engine, ambulance and wrecker are executing an emergency task, other vehicles should yield.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:A

14、When encountering an ambulance rushing in the same lane in the opposite direction, the driver should ________.

A. Move to the road side, reduce speed or stop to yield

B. Drive on by using another lane

C. Speed up and change lane to avoid

D. Continue to go in the original lane

Answer:A

16、How to drive in sand, hail, rain, fog, ice and other weather conditions?

A. run as normal

B. maintain the speed

C. speed up properly

D. reduce the speed

Answer:D

19、May throw items to the road while driving.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:B

20、As the road is wet and slippery after rain, brake application when driving can easily ___.

A. Cause sideways slide and traffic accident

B. Cause collision due to poor visibility

C. Be ignored by the drivers of other vehicles

D. Cause engine kill

Answer:A
